2. Spectacular Landscapes: The landscapes of New Mexico are stunning throughout the year, but December adds a magical touch. The snow-capped mountains and the crisp, clear air create a serene atmosphere that’s perfect for hiking, skiing, and snowboarding. The Sangre de Cristo Mountains, for instance, offer excellent opportunities for winter sports enthusiasts.
3. Cultural Experiences: New Mexico is a melting pot of cultures, with a significant Native American, Spanish, and Mexican influence. December is a great time to immerse yourself in the local culture. You can attend traditional Native American dances, visit museums showcasing the state’s history, and enjoy the local cuisine.

Top Destinations to Explore
1. Santa Fe: Known as the “City Different,” Santa Fe is a must-visit destination. Explore the historic Plaza, visit art galleries, and enjoy the unique blend of Native American, Spanish, and Puebloan cultures.
2. Albuquerque: Home to the famous Balloon Fiesta, Albuquerque offers a range of activities from hiking in the Sandia Mountains to exploring the city’s rich history.
3. Taos: Taos is a picturesque town with stunning mountain views and a vibrant arts scene. Visit the Taos Pueblo, the oldest continuously inhabited village in the United States.
